Rethink’s award-winning, research-based program provides support to parents raising children with learning or behavior challenges, or developmental disabilities at no cost to you. Rethink has no age restrictions, requires no diagnosis and is completely confidential.
Benefits
Parents can take advantage of one-on-one consultation with learning and behavior experts to answer questions and provide guidance as you support your child in reaching their top potential. Consultations can take place over the phone or via video chat, day or night, weekday or weekend. Common consultation topics include:
- Teaching new skills and troubleshooting lack of progress
- Collaborating with school and other providers
- Coping with the stress of a new diagnosis or ongoing daily struggles at home
- Getting the most out of the Rethink platform
All consultations are confidential and HIPAA compliant for US based employees.
